Do think tanks pay well?

According to Indeed, the average think tank salary is $66,000.” Junior analysts and professional scholars and staffers at think tanks make between $35,000 and $50,000 annually. Mid-level think tank scholars and analysts earn from $50,000 to $80,000. Senior analysts are typically paid $80,000 to $200,000.

Do think tanks exist?

During the Cold War, many more American and Western think tanks were established, which often guided governmental Cold War policy. Since 1991, more think tanks have been established in non-Western parts of the world. More than half of all think tanks that exist today were established after 1980.

What makes a think tank successful?

To succeed, think tanks need at least four elements. They need good ideas, a coalition of actors to support those ideas, the institutional capacity (including resources) to nurture and shepherd those ideas in a dynamic context, and the ability to seize the moment when the timing is right.

Do you need a PhD to work for a think tank?

Some think tanks may ask for a master or a PhD for policy roles, whilst others will employ people without a further study degree. Others come from more specialist fields that are relevant to the think tank, e.g. from education or health. Roles are open to any degree background, although a passion for policy is key!

WHO donates to think tanks?

Donations to these think tanks came from 68 different U.S. government and defense contractor sources, under at least 600 separate donations. The top five defense contractor donors to U.S. think tanks were Northrop Grumman, Raytheon, Boeing, Lockheed Martina and Air Bus.

Can a think tank be a nonprofit?

Think tanks are distinct from government, and many are nonprofit organizations, but their work may be conducted for governmental as well as commercial clients. Projects for government clients often involve planning social policy and national defense.
